A fantastic opportunity to purchase this delightful double fronted cottage, offering a deceptive level of accommodation extending to approximately 2,185 sq.ft. including a large contemporary style extension to the rear.

Located in the heart of this ever-popular village, the property has an abundance of charm and character including 2 cosy beamed reception rooms to the front, 1 housing an open fireplace. There is a garden room overlooking the rear courtyard and a versatile space currently used as a home office and library. The fantastic dining kitchen is a particular feature of the property, is fitted with a bespoke range of handcrafted units and has plenty of space for dining and entertaining. There is a useful utility room and ground floor shower room plus a large all-round room across the rear with a secondary staircase rising to the 4th bedroom; a versatile space that works well combined with the main living accommodation or as a separate annex if preferred. There are 4 double bedrooms in total plus a fantastic 4-piece family bathroom and an en-suite shower room.

The property occupies a mature plot including driveway standing to the front and a lawn with stepping stone pathway leading to the front door. There is a further gravelled driveway to the very rear of the plot as well as a delightful and fully enclosed courtyard style garden and viewing is highly recommended to appreciate the deceptive level of character filled accommodation on offer.

Accommodation - A part glazed entrance door leads into the entrance porch.

Entrance Porch - A glazed porch area with decorative tiled flooring leading to a small hallway which provides a staircase to the first floor and latch and brace doors to each side into the front reception rooms.

Lounge - With stripped wooden floorboards and timber beams to the ceiling plus double glazed windows to the side and front elevations and a central heating radiator. The focal point of the room is a feature open fire with brick insert and slate hearth housing a cast iron dog grate.

Sitting Room - With oak flooring and painted timber beams to the ceiling, a double glazed window to the front aspect, a useful storage cupboard under the stairs and an exposed red brick decorative chimney breast. A latch and brace door leads into the office/library.

Office/Library - A useful and versatile space with terracotta tiled flooring, painted timber beams to the ceiling, a useful fixed corner desk and bespoke handmade wall to wall fitted bookcases with useful cupboards beneath. There is a central heating radiator and access into the garden room.

Garden Room - A lovely space with glazed door onto the rear courtyard, tiled flooring and feature exposed red brick wall.

Dining Kitchen - A fantastic dining kitchen fitted with a range of bespoke handmade base and larder style cabinets with solid timber worktops and upstands and an undermounted Carron Phoenix double bowl ceramic sink with swan neck mixer tap and drainer grooves to the side. Integrated appliances include a large ceramic hob with chimney extractor hood over, a built-in eye level double oven by Siemens, an integrated Bosch dishwasher and an integrated fridge freezer. The kitchen features deep pan drawers, useful pull-out larder style cupboards, and plenty of storage cupboards. Tiled flooring throughout, double glazed windows and a part glazed stable door into the courtyard, timber beams and spotlights to the ceiling, a central heating radiator, space for dining and access into the sun room with feature vaulted ceiling and large skylight plus double glazed picture window into the courtyard, tiled flooring, glazed double doors into the family room and a door into the utility.

Utility - A useful space with tiled flooring and fitted with a range of base units with rolled edge worktops, space for appliances including plumbing for a washing machine, a vaulted ceiling with high level drying rack, central heating radiator and a wall mounted Baxi combination boiler.

Family Room - A large and versatile space forming part of the extension across the rear with slate tiled floor, spotlights to the ceiling, underfloor heating, a staircase rising to the first floor bedroom, a double glazed window to the rear aspect and glazed French doors onto the courtyard garden.

Ground Floor Shower Room - A useful shower room fitted with a traditional style suite including a close coupled toilet and a pedestal wash basin with hot and cold taps. There is a shower enclosure with Mira Sport electric shower plus tiling to the walls, tiled flooring, a central heating radiator and extractor fan.

First Floor Landing - With a central heating radiator, a double glazed window to the side aspect and a useful bespoke storage cupboard with shelving.

Bedroom One - A double bedroom with a central heating radiator, a double glazed window to the front aspect, a useful storage cupboard over the stairs with a hanging rail and having access hatch to the roof space. There is a fitted double wardrobe with hanging rail plus a feature cast iron decorative period fireplace.

Bedroom Two - A double bedroom with a central heating radiator, a double glazed window to the front aspect and an attractive decorative cast iron fireplace.

Bedroom Three - A good sized double bedroom with double glazed windows to the side and rear aspects, a central heating radiator and a comprehensive range of handmade fitted furniture including a fitted chest of drawers, a double wardrobe with hanging rail and a bedframe with overhead linen lockers, downlights over the bed and bedside tables.

Main Bathroom - A superb four piece bathroom with a feature freestanding dual ended bath, a close coupled toilet and a floor-standing vanity wash basin with granite surround, mixer tap and cupboards and drawers below. There is a shower area with fixed glazed screen and mains fed rainfall shower with a handheld spray hose, toiletry niche, tiling for splashbacks and decorative flooring tiling plus a high level double glazed skylight, feature panelling to the walls and a traditional style towel radiator in white and chrome.

Bedroom Four/Annexe Bedroom - A double bedroom with a central heating radiator, spotlights to the ceiling, Velux skylights, a double glazed window to the rear aspect and a door into the en-suite shower room.

En-Suite Shower Room - Including a concealed cistern toilet, a large shower enclosure with glazed folding doors and mains fed shower and a vanity wash basin with glass bowl and mixer tap. Electric shaver points, tiling for splashbacks, spotlights to the ceiling and a Velux skylight plus chrome towel radiator.

Outside - A generous and lawned front garden has a stepping stone pathway leading to the front door, with gated access at the front providing off street parking. There is an attractive and fully enclosed courtyard style garden which is decked and has gated access to the rear where further gravelled parking can be found alongside the useful timber log store and shed.

Council Tax - The property is registered as council tax band F.
